Oniric dawn. A mix of memories and imaginary landscapes.  My willing is showing the atmosphere of a late summer dawn; before the beating sun shines again, when raindrops of dew still tremble on the grass. G M Escribano is fascinated by the atmospheric landscape and how its shapes and meteors evoke emotions. He recreates clouds, which represent the constant change and chaos described by natural laws. His paintings are an invitation to introspection. Creating is a humanizing act and an internal rebellion. Acrylic and oil are the mediums he uses to create the landscapes that move him. He is currently living in the Penedès Region (NE Spain); surrounded by vineyards and close to the Mediterranean Sea.
